What is PCl3 in chemistry?

chemicals. Phosphorus trichloride (PCl3) is used as a chemical intermediate to produce a variety of products which are used in several applications including agricultural products, surfactants and metal extractants, flame retardants, additives for lubricants and stabilizers for plastics.

Is HCl ionic or covalent?

Sodium chloride is an ionic compound. Many bonds can be covalent in one situation and ionic in another. For instance, hydrogen chloride, HCl, is a gas in which the hydrogen and chlorine are covalently bound, but if HCl is bubbled into water, it ionizes completely to give the H+ and Cl- of a hydrochloric acid solution.

Is PCl3 a polar covalent bond?

PCl3 is polar, because of its trigonal pyramidal structure. Only 3 of the 5 valence electrons of the phosphorus are used for bonding with chlorine, so the other two are unshared. The three chlorine atoms are thus not in the same plane as the phosphorus atom.

Is PCl3 dipole dipole?

(a) PCl3 is polar while PCl5 is nonpolar. As such, the only intermolecular forces active in PCl5 are induced dipole-induced dipole forces (London dispersion forces). In PCl3, there are also dipole-dipole forces and dipole-induced dipole forces.

Is PCl3 tetrahedral?

The shape of a P C l 3 PCl_3 PCl3 molecule is Trigonal pyramidal. The central P atom has one lone pair of electrons and three bond pairs of electrons. It undergoes s p 3 displaystyle sp^3 sp3 hybridisation which results in tetrahedral electron pair geometry and Trigonal pyramidal molecular geometry.

Can PCl3 be made?

Phosphorus trichloride is prepared industrially by the reaction of chlorine with a refluxing solution of white phosphorus in phosphorus trichloride, with continuous removal of PCl3 as it is formed.
